Dziurdziewo [d͡ʑurˈd͡ʑɛvɔ] (formerly German: Thalheim[1]) is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Kozłowo, within Nidzica County, Warmian-Masurian Voivodeship, in northern Poland.[2] It lies approximately 15 kilometres (9 mi) west of Nidzica and 49 km (30 mi) south-west of the regional capital Olsztyn.
